Basgara is a Rural village located in Raniganj, Araria, Bihar.
The total population of Basgara is 545.
Basgara village comprises 109 households.
The literacy rate in Basgara is 59.4%. Among the literate population of 275, there are 174 literate males and 101 literate females.
In Basgara, there are 274 males and 271 females, with a sex ratio of 989 females per 1000 males.
There are 82 children (15% of population), comprising 39 boys and 43 girls.
The total number of workers in Basgara is 269, with 268 main workers and 1 marginal workers.
In Basgara, there are 88 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(46 males, 42 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Basgara is located in Bihar state, Araria district, and falls under Raniganj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 221723 and LGD code is 221723.
